Is there any reason NOT to enable busybox sha3sums?
(I don't care busybox-udeb or busybox-static.)

    
https://sources.debian.org/src/busybox/1%3A1.35.0-1/debian/config/pkg/deb/#L280

    -# CONFIG_SHA3SUM is not set
    +CONFIG_SHA3SUM=y


Per this handy reference table, everyone should be on SHA-3 by now:

    https://valerieaurora.org/hash.html


I'd like to switch from b2sum to sha3sum, but

1) Debian only ships coreutils 8.32, and even
   latest coreutils (9.1) lacks "cksum -a sha3"; and

2) Debian's busybox is built without "busybox sha3sum".

3) Debian's python3 understands SHA-3 (hashlib.sha3_512), but
   lacks a turnkey equivalent of
   "sha3sum --check SHA3SUMS" and
   "sha3sum --tag -- *.changes >SHA3SUMS".
